NEW LEGISLATION AFECTING CHILD SUPPORT
On October 8, 2021, the Domestic Relations Act was amended to provide possible support for adult children through age 26. See DRL, Chapter 437 of the Laws of 2021) Also, the Family Court Act added a like provision in its Section 413-b. Both provisions provide possibilities for petitions for continued child support for adult children with certain qualifying disabilities. The Mental Hygiene law controls the controlling definition of what diagnosis would qualify for purposes of a developmental disability in an adult child.
